Model Features
This model is a pure 3D printed manual push-button fan, requiring no glue and no hardware
It can be folded and easily placed in your pocket, making it compact
Minimal support, negligible, easy to print, strong airflow to help you stay cool all summer
This model provides three types of fan blades, each with different characteristics. Please print and test them yourself
Double-layer four-blade foldable fan blade, single-layer two-blade foldable fan blade, five-blade fixed-axis fan blade
Printing Notes
The fan blades of this model have an open structure and may cause bodily harm due to accidental touch, material breakage, runaway blades, etc. Please use this model at your own risk.
The screws used in this model are all 3D printed. Printing them on a single plate will severely affect the screw print quality, so they are divided into two plates. Please do not combine printing
It is recommended to print this model with PETG. PLA can also be used, but its lifespan will be severely reduced
If you encounter issues with installation or smooth operation, you can slightly scale down or up the gears and screws when printing
Installation Instructions
This model consists of four gears. Please refer to the introductory image for installation
It is recommended to apply lubricant to the gears, especially in the holes connecting the gears and the pull rod. Insufficient lubrication may cause abnormal noise during use, but it will not affect the support operation
The screws in this model are all 3D printed and require a screwdriver. Do not apply too much force during installation to prevent screw breakage
Before installing the screws, please test them to see if they run smoothly. If not, please check if the parts have flaws, stringing, defects, cooling lines, or seams. If necessary, reprint or manually sand them
Many users have reported that it does not run smoothly. Actual testing suggests this may be due to varying printer print quality among users
When assembling, please test each gear individually to ensure it runs smoothly in its respective position and check for any flaws
If you find that a gear does not run smoothly in its corresponding position, please print the compatible version of that gear—compatible gear
The gears are numbered 1 to 4 from bottom to top; please only print the gears that do not operate correctly.
